** The home solar market in Tubac, Arizona, is characterized by high-quality, specialized service providers rather than a high volume of national competitors. Due to Tubac's affluent demographics and high sun exposure, the market leans towards premium, whole-home energy solutions, including robust battery backup systems for off-grid capability or resilience during power fluctuations, which can be common in rural areas. **Competition Level:** Moderate. While there aren't dozens of installers physically located in Tubac, the competition to serve the area from Tucson and Green Valley is strong among a handful of established, reputable companies. This benefits the consumer as they are choosing from proven, high-caliber providers. **Average Quality:** Very High. The companies that successfully serve Tubac are typically long-standing, have excellent certifications (like NABCEP), and use top-tier equipment. Customer service and system reliability are key differentiators.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is competitive with the national average but can trend slightly higher due to the custom nature of many installations, the frequent inclusion of battery storage, and the high quality of components used. The federal solar investment tax credit (ITC) and potential local incentives significantly reduce the net cost. Cash purchases for a typical residential system might range from $25,000 to $45,000+ before incentives, with financed and leased options making systems accessible with little or no money down.
